SitesSDK.Utils.addSiteThemeDesign(cssUrl)

Эта функция создает элемент link в HTML-теге <head> текущей страницы. Источник задается для пути cssUrl.

Параметры

Внимание.:

Функции пространства имен Utils официально компанией Oracle не поддерживаются. Они предназначены для использования в качестве примеров реализации. Используйте их на свой страх и риск.
Имя Тип Описание

cssUrl

строка

URL-адрес текущего дизайна темы. Используйте только с удаленными компонентами.

Локальные компоненты (реализованные в iframe) должны извлекать из страницы свойства, а не URL-адрес.

Синтаксис

Эта функция обычно используется в сочетании с извлечением текущего дизайна темы из сайта хоста, как показано в этом примере кода:

// fetch current theme design from host site and then add it to the page

SitesSDK.getSiteProperty('theme',function(data){
                // check if we got an url back
                if ( data.url && typeof data.url === 'string' ) {
                                if ( data.url !== '') {
                                          // theme is loaded so dynamically inject theme
                                          SitesSDK.Utils.addSiteThemeDesign(data.url);
                                }
                }
        });